Rubber synchronous belt: a key role in the field of industrial transmission

In the complex mechanical system of modern industry, rubber synchronous belt is an indispensable and important component.

Rubber synchronous belt is widely used in many industrial fields with its unique advantages. In terms of working principle, it relies on the precise meshing of the belt and the tooth shape on the pulley to transmit power. This meshing method makes the transmission highly accurate. In high-speed production equipment, such as automated assembly lines, rubber synchronous belts can ensure the precise matching of each link, and will not cause the product processing accuracy to decrease due to transmission deviation.

Its durability is also its remarkable feature. The selection of rubber materials and the improvement of manufacturing process enable the synchronous belt to withstand long-term friction and tension. In some heavy machinery manufacturing plants, the equipment needs to operate continuously, and the rubber synchronous belt can work stably for a long time, reducing the cost and time of frequent replacement of parts.

Moreover, the rubber synchronous belt has good adaptability. It can adapt to different working environments and power requirements. Whether in a foundry workshop under high temperature environment or in a precision instrument manufacturing site with strict requirements on noise, through special rubber formula and structural design, the rubber synchronous belt can play a good transmission effect and reduce noise generation.

In addition, rubber synchronous belts also contribute to environmental protection and energy saving. Precise transmission means effective energy transmission, reducing waste caused by energy loss. In today's pursuit of green manufacturing, rubber synchronous belts are playing an increasingly important role in the industrial transmission stage with their unique advantages, driving industrial manufacturing towards a more efficient, more precise and more environmentally friendly direction.
